Our late mayor, Bill Bell, established in 2006 an annual Young Entrepreneur Award.

This year's recipient is Annie Rong

This 17-year-old Richmond Hiller resident is the successful founder of a custom tote-bag company, Fill Your Tote!  Her distinctive artistic ideas have made Fill Your Tote! stand out for its sleek and original style. 

Annie, along with 9 others, took part in Summer Company, a program helping students ages 15-29 learn how to run their own business. 

As a participant of Summer Company, Annie was able to step out of her comfort zone. She encountered challenges, like pricing issues and tough gatekeepers, but never gave up. Her focus on forming quality connections and partnerships paid off with her tote bags being sold at the 2023 CNE, various markets and fairs, and gift shops.
